Output db4afd97feb3846466917af8d2e0ad5875c9b6627a63358cfd188ecc4c63ce2d:197

value
23715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a9eebdf22c60ea017ff53848bac59c2408da375 OP_EQUAL
address
3QYBEYy615UjJyTgHsQuaBKUVJD5U23Bgh
transaction
db4afd97feb3846466917af8d2e0ad5875c9b6627a63358cfd188ecc4c63ce2d
confirmations
5597
spent
true